Summary
The Procurement Manager is responsible for managing the procurement
processes, ensuring cost-effective and timely purchasing of goods
and services, and maintaining positive supplier relationships. The
role involves developing procurement strategies, negotiating
contracts, ensuring compliance with procurement policies, and
collaborating with various departments to meet the company's
operational needs.
What will you get to do?
Develop and implement procurement strategies to ensure
cost-effective purchasing while maintaining high quality and timely
delivery of goods and services.
Identify and evaluate potential suppliers, conduct due diligence,
and establish strong relationships with key vendors.
Lead the negotiation of contracts and terms of agreement, ensuring
favorable pricing, delivery, and payment terms.
Manage the entire procurement process from supplier selection to
contract management and purchase order creation.
Monitor market trends, supply chain conditions, and new suppliers
to ensure a competitive advantage.
Ensure compliance with the company's procurement policies and
procedures, as well as legal and regulatory requirements.
Collaborate with internal departments (e.g., operations, finance,
and production) to understand procurement needs and ensure
alignment with company goals.
Monitor and manage supplier performance, addressing issues related
to quality, delivery, and cost.
Develop, track, and report key performance metrics related to
procurement (e.g., cost savings, supplier performance, lead
times).
Manage the procurement budget and provide regular updates to senior
management on cost-saving initiatives and supplier performance.
Continuously evaluate and optimize the procurement process to
improve efficiency and reduce costs.
Lead, mentor, and develop a team of procurement professionals.
